In addition to his academic career, Mr. Ammirati mentors postgraduate students to develop innovative business ideas. His recent guidance has led to the creation of a long-distance relationship app and a personalized fitness app.
This year’s student work has made exceptional progress, owing to generative artificial intelligence. Students developed innovative solutions and designs, gaining the attention of interested industries. The new emphasis on AI usage has improved students’ comprehension and problem-solving abilities.
Students are encouraged to use AI as a ‘co-founder,’ integrating tools like ChatGPT, GitHub Copilot, and FlowiseAI into their projects.

This facilitated coding, product development, marketing, and client acquisition.
AI also immensely improved the efficiency of students’ research and development processes. Simultaneously, a dedicated Slack channel served as an active platform for brainstorming, idea exchanging, technical problem-solving, and tracking project progress.
Students learned the value of AI tools as crucial partners in their entrepreneurial journey. These tools streamlined product development and coding processes and other facets of starting a new business venture.
The innovative approach attracted several venture capitalists, who were ready to support and finance these promising ventures. The investors recognized the potential of generative AI for transforming business operations, drawing parallels with the disruptive impacts of cloud and mobile technologies in the mid-2000s.
Mr. Ammirati firmly believes in generative AI’s transformative potential, stating that its potential impact could even transcend previous technological innovations.
